Version: 6.8.0-132.133 2026-06-21 18:10:29 UTC

 linux (6.8.0-132.133) noble; urgency=medium
 .
   * noble/linux: 6.8.0-132.133 -proposed tracker (LP: #2157456)
 .
   * mount08 from ubuntu_ltp_syscalls failed - TFAIL: mount(/proc/139835/fd/4)
     succeeded (LP: #2137199)
     - proc: proc_readfd() -> proc_fd_iterate()
     - proc: proc_readfdinfo() -> proc_fdinfo_iterate()
     - proc: add proc_splice_unmountable()
     - proc: block mounting on top of /proc//map_files/*
     - proc: block mounting on top of /proc//fd/*
     - proc: block mounting on top of /proc//fdinfo/*
 .
   * Add intel-speed-select to linux-tools-$(uname -r) (LP: #2131077)
     - [Packaging] Add intel-speed-select to linux-tools
 .
